summaryrefslogtreecommitdiff
path: root/src/mainboard/bap
diff options
context:
space:
mode:
authorKyösti Mälkki <kyosti.malkki@gmail.com>2019-11-23 20:22:09 +0200
committerKyösti Mälkki <kyosti.malkki@gmail.com>2019-12-15 17:11:47 +0000
commitb320bc5e0e6863126b57166923f3e0fac96bbb0c (patch)
tree97745cdb7d6ac4f8e86373e97d6d737e1162d829 /src/mainboard/bap
parentd912df22a8fde68dc513824d757b71eb16703479 (diff)
downloadcoreboot-b320bc5e0e6863126b57166923f3e0fac96bbb0c.tar.xz
AGESA: Disable boards from build
As per the 4.11 release requirement, C_ENVIRONMENT_BOOTBLOCK=y is a mandatory feature, which most AGESA and binaryPI boards lack. Disable such platforms from the build for the time being. The Kconfig symbol has been flipped, ROMCC_BOOTBLOCK=n is the same mandated feature as C_ENVIRONMENT_BOOTBLOCK=y. If a platform does not reach ROMCC_BOOTBLOCK=n within a reasonable timeframe both the mainboard and the respective unused platform support code will get removed. Change-Id: I7fceb0370f7f4f5f52080277c5d21615d3ab3454 Signed-off-by: Kyösti Mälkki <kyosti.malkki@gmail.com> Reviewed-on: https://review.coreboot.org/c/coreboot/+/37355 Tested-by: build bot (Jenkins) <no-reply@coreboot.org> Reviewed-by: Arthur Heymans <arthur@aheymans.xyz>
Diffstat (limited to 'src/mainboard/bap')
-rw-r--r--src/mainboard/bap/Kconfig4
-rw-r--r--src/mainboard/bap/ode_e20XX/Kconfig5
-rw-r--r--src/mainboard/bap/ode_e20XX/Kconfig.name4
-rw-r--r--src/mainboard/bap/ode_e21XX/Kconfig2
4 files changed, 11 insertions, 4 deletions
diff --git a/src/mainboard/bap/Kconfig b/src/mainboard/bap/Kconfig
index 9af496dca6..a638509026 100644
--- a/src/mainboard/bap/Kconfig
+++ b/src/mainboard/bap/Kconfig
@@ -13,6 +13,7 @@
## M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
## GNU General Public License for more details.
##
+
if VENDOR_BAP
choice
@@ -20,6 +21,9 @@ choice
source "src/mainboard/bap/*/Kconfig.name"
+config BAP_BOARDS_DISABLED
+ bool "Boards from vendor are disabled"
+
endchoice
source "src/mainboard/bap/*/Kconfig"
diff --git a/src/mainboard/bap/ode_e20XX/Kconfig b/src/mainboard/bap/ode_e20XX/Kconfig
index 97593d5d78..2a72debf58 100644
--- a/src/mainboard/bap/ode_e20XX/Kconfig
+++ b/src/mainboard/bap/ode_e20XX/Kconfig
@@ -14,11 +14,14 @@
# GNU General Public License for more details.
#
+config BOARD_ODE_E20XX
+ def_bool n
+
if BOARD_ODE_E20XX
config BOARD_SPECIFIC_OPTIONS
def_bool y
- select ROMCC_BOOTBLOCK
+ #select ROMCC_BOOTBLOCK
select CPU_AMD_AGESA_FAMILY16_KB
select NORTHBRIDGE_AMD_AGESA_FAMILY16_KB
select SOUTHBRIDGE_AMD_AGESA_YANGTZE
diff --git a/src/mainboard/bap/ode_e20XX/Kconfig.name b/src/mainboard/bap/ode_e20XX/Kconfig.name
index a482846808..54ddcac682 100644
--- a/src/mainboard/bap/ode_e20XX/Kconfig.name
+++ b/src/mainboard/bap/ode_e20XX/Kconfig.name
@@ -1,2 +1,2 @@
-config BOARD_ODE_E20XX
- bool "ODE_e20xx"
+#config BOARD_ODE_E20XX
+# bool"ODE_e20xx"
diff --git a/src/mainboard/bap/ode_e21XX/Kconfig b/src/mainboard/bap/ode_e21XX/Kconfig
index bc5c131f79..ff71d5bdc3 100644
--- a/src/mainboard/bap/ode_e21XX/Kconfig
+++ b/src/mainboard/bap/ode_e21XX/Kconfig
@@ -21,7 +21,7 @@ if BOARD_ODE_E21XX
config BOARD_SPECIFIC_OPTIONS
def_bool y
#select BINARYPI_LEGACY_WRAPPER
- select ROMCC_BOOTBLOCK
+ #select ROMCC_BOOTBLOCK
select CPU_AMD_PI_00730F01
select NORTHBRIDGE_AMD_PI_00730F01
select SOUTHBRIDGE_AMD_PI_AVALON